Consortium to build hydrogen, DRI plants in Fos-sur-Mer

A consortium of European energy and steel related companies has established a new joint venture called GravitHy to build a hydrogen and direct reduced iron plant in the south of France. This is being touted as a large-scale venture that will also heavily contribute to the French hydrogen economy.
